Key Points:

  • Trainer Yoshito Yahagi confirmed that Forever Young will not race in the 2027 Breeders’ Cup at Belmont Park but may compete early next year, possibly aiming for a third consecutive win in the Saudi Cup in February.
  • Forever Young is set to run in the Grade 1, $1 million Jockey Club Gold Cup at Belmont Park on Friday as a prep race before attempting to repeat his Breeders’ Cup Classic victory at Keeneland on October 31.
  • Yahagi praised Forever Young's recent training, highlighting an impressive five-furlong workout and noting the horse's significant improvement from age four to five.
  • Despite having only raced twice this year, Forever Young won the Saudi Cup in February and placed second in the Dubai World Cup in March, demonstrating continued top-level performance.
